About 18 Norwich Road
18 Norwich Road is a three-bedroom semi-detached house in Besthorpe, Attleborough, Attleborough (NR17 2LB). It has a recorded floor area of 90 m² (around 969 sq ft) and construction records dating it to 2007 onwards. The latest certificate (June 2016) shows a C (score 77), near the top of the C band. The recommended improvements would push it to B (score 90). The latest certificate is from June 2016, so improvements made since then won't be reflected. Other recorded features include a conservatory. The home occupies a cul-de-sac position.
At 90 m² it sits well below the postcode median (134 m² across 48 EPCs), making it one of the more compact homes locally. Across 2015–2022, sale prices on this property compounded at 3.3% per year.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£310/sq ft) was about 74.6%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Most recent transfer: March 2022 at £300,000. That sale was during the post-pandemic price surge, when transactions cleared materially above pre-2020 trend.
